文件名称:使用 fft(x) 和 ifft(X) 的循环卷积:使用离散傅立叶变换特性的循环卷积。-matlab开发
文件大小:26KB
文件格式:ZIP
更新时间:2024-06-18 07:54:05
matlab
步骤 1:获得序列 x (n) 和 h (h) 的 N 点 DFT: x (n) → X (k) h (n) → H (k) Step-2:将两个序列X(k)和H(k)相乘: Y (k) → X (k) H (k) ,对于 k=0,1,2,...,N-1 Step-3:获得序列Y(k)的N点IDFT,得到最终输出y(n) Y (k) → y (n),对于 n=0,1,2,.....,N-1 例如 输入 x(n): [1 1 1 1 1 0 0 0] 输入h(n): [1 1 1 1 1 0 0 0] 第一序列x(n)为: 1 1 1 1 1 0 0 0 第二个序列 h(n) 是: 1 1 1 1 1 0 0 0 卷积序列 y(n) 为: 2 2 3 4 5 4 3 2
【文件预览】:
c_convolution_dft.m.mltbx
c_convolution_dft.m.zip